Description

Short description
Massive bowls for cinnabar are coated with shiny yellowish-brown glaze on the inside and on the upper edge. At the sides and on the bottom of the vessels, the red cinnabar colour glitters. The bowls are not round, but a combined outline of a circle and a triangle.
Measures
Length 40–41 cm, width 39.3–41 cm, height 15.5–19 cm.

Original use
The bowls served for carrying cinnabar in the Cinnabar Factory of the Idrija Mercury Mine.
Present use
The described items (5 in total) are being preserved, secured and presented as important mining heritage of Idrija with exceptional universal values. Most of them are a part of the mining collection of the Idrija Municipal Museum. Visitors can view one item within the permanent museum exhibition “Five Centuries of the Mercury Mine and the Town of Idrija”. The rest of them are stored in the depot and can be used for temporary museum exhibitions. They can be used for different types of mercury heritage promotions.
